well they aren't all really "watercooling friendly".

The internals of almost all coolermaster models are pretty much the same.

The best thing to do for watercooling (which I'm going to do) is cut a 120mm hole at the top of the case, and mount the heatercore up there.
I've got the ATC111C-SX2 case, and a JR-120 heatercore from dtek will fit in quite snugly.
